| /** |
| * Helper functions for configuring multiple {@code InputFormat} instances within a single |
| * Crunch MapReduce job. |
| */ |
| public class CrunchInputs { |
| public static final String CRUNCH_INPUTS = "crunch.inputs.dir"; |
| |
| private static final char RECORD_SEP = ','; |
| private static final char FIELD_SEP = ';'; |
| private static final char PATH_SEP = '|'; |
| private static final Joiner JOINER = Joiner.on(FIELD_SEP); |
| private static final Splitter SPLITTER = Splitter.on(FIELD_SEP); |
| |
| public static void addInputPath(Job job, Path path, FormatBundle inputBundle, int nodeIndex) { |
| addInputPaths(job, Collections.singleton(path), inputBundle, nodeIndex); |
| } |
| |
| public static void addInputPaths(Job job, Collection<Path> paths, FormatBundle inputBundle, int nodeIndex) { |
| Configuration conf = job.getConfiguration(); |
| List<String> encodedPathStrs = Lists.newArrayListWithExpectedSize(paths.size()); |
| for (Path path : paths) { |
| String pathStr = encodePath(path); |
| Preconditions.checkArgument(pathStr.indexOf(RECORD_SEP) == -1 && pathStr.indexOf(FIELD_SEP) == -1 && pathStr.indexOf(PATH_SEP) == -1); |
| encodedPathStrs.add(pathStr); |
| } |
| String inputs = JOINER.join(inputBundle.serialize(), String.valueOf(nodeIndex), Joiner.on(PATH_SEP).join(encodedPathStrs)); |
| String existing = conf.get(CRUNCH_INPUTS); |
| conf.set(CRUNCH_INPUTS, existing == null ? inputs : existing + RECORD_SEP + inputs); |
| } |
| |
| public static Map<FormatBundle, Map<Integer, List<Path>>> getFormatNodeMap(JobContext job) { |
| Map<FormatBundle, Map<Integer, List<Path>>> formatNodeMap = Maps.newHashMap(); |
| Configuration conf = job.getConfiguration(); |
| String crunchInputs = conf.get(CRUNCH_INPUTS); |
| if (crunchInputs == null || crunchInputs.isEmpty()) { |
| return ImmutableMap.of(); |
| } |
| for (String input : Splitter.on(RECORD_SEP).split(crunchInputs)) { |
| List<String> fields = Lists.newArrayList(SPLITTER.split(input)); |
| FormatBundle<InputFormat> inputBundle = FormatBundle.fromSerialized(fields.get(0), job.getConfiguration()); |
| if (!formatNodeMap.containsKey(inputBundle)) { |
| formatNodeMap.put(inputBundle, Maps.<Integer, List<Path>>newHashMap()); |
| } |
| Integer nodeIndex = Integer.valueOf(fields.get(1)); |
| if (!formatNodeMap.get(inputBundle).containsKey(nodeIndex)) { |
| formatNodeMap.get(inputBundle).put(nodeIndex, Lists.<Path>newLinkedList()); |
| } |
| List<Path> formatNodePaths = formatNodeMap.get(inputBundle).get(nodeIndex); |
| String encodedPaths = fields.get(2); |
| for (String encodedPath : Splitter.on(PATH_SEP).split(encodedPaths)) { |
| formatNodePaths.add(decodePath(encodedPath)); |
| } |
| } |
| return formatNodeMap; |
| } |
| |
| private static String encodePath(Path path) { |
| try { |
| return URLEncoder.encode(path.toString(), "UTF-8"); |
| } catch (UnsupportedEncodingException e) { |
| throw new RuntimeException(e); |
| } |
| } |
| |
| private static Path decodePath(String encodedPath) { |
| try { |
| return new Path(URLDecoder.decode(encodedPath, "UTF-8")); |
| } catch (UnsupportedEncodingException e) { |
| throw new RuntimeException(e); |
| } |
| } |
| |
| } |
